5. They're Pinkertons
Back in the day, a hundred years ago, when the miners were striking or workers were trying to organize,
the mine owners and the money bags knew that local police were the neighbors, and sometimes the friends
or relatives of some of the protesters.

So they imported goons from the Pinkerton Agency.

Some of the Pinkerton agents did double duty as infiltrators (James McParlan wormed his way in with the
Molly McGuires), acting as spies and sometimes agents provacateurs.
